The invention relates to a control device, to a hybrid device, to a method for operating an arrangement for processing data packets, to an arrangement for processing data packets and to an electronic device.
DE 103 10 115 A1 discloses an arrangement for remotely controlling a mobile radio telephone in a motor ‘vehicle. This arrangement comprises an independent interface module which, as an output unit, also establishes a standardized interface to a CAN bus, the interface module also comprising a communication management unit in which the data formats are converted between the radio telephone and the output unit. The disadvantage of this arrangement is that the communication management unit must have the device-specific instruction sets for data transmission, so that the unit can convert the data formats between the radio telephone and the input and output units. In this arrangement according to the prior art, the interface module is used to translate between the language of the vehicle bus and the language of the mobile radio telephone using computation power.
Nowadays, a control device which is permanently installed in a vehicle and is designed as a gateway unit or an interface unit must support vehicle-related applications on an electronic device, in particular a mobile telephone, over the entire service life of the vehicle, in which case it must be taken into account that new and more complex applications may thoroughly overtax the computation power and hardware configuration of the control device permanently installed in the vehicle.
The object of the invention is to propose a control device for a vehicle bus, a hybrid device, a method for operating an arrangement for processing data packets, an arrangement for processing data packets and an electronic device which simplify integration or connection of the electronic device into or to a vehicle bus and increase the performance thereof.
The object of the invention is, in particular, to propose a control device for a vehicle bus, which device forms a gateway for a vehicle-related application running on an electronic device, in particular a mobile electronic device such as, in particular, a mobile telephone. In this case, the intention is to avoid restriction or limitation of such an application, which would result from excessively low computation power or insufficient hardware integration of the control device operating as a gateway.
Furthermore, the object of the invention is, in particular, to propose a hybrid device, a method for operating an arrangement for processing data packets and an arrangement for processing data packets which are upward-compatible without the need to update a control device installed in the vehicle when the electronic device is changed. Furthermore, the object of the invention is to minimize the computational complexity, which is required when operating an electronic device on a vehicle bus, in a control device.
Finally, the object of the invention is, in particular, to propose an electronic device which is designed, in particular, as a mobile electronic device and, in particular, as a mobile telephone, which can be connected to a vehicle bus using the control device according to the invention.
The essence of the invention is the practice of moving part of the functionality of a control device to another electronic device which has the application. The essence of the invention is thus the practice of moving some of the functions or layers of the control device to the electronic device which is designed, in particular, as a mobile telephone, some of the original control device functions being implemented using software within the framework of an application which can be installed on hardware of the electronic device. In other words, the load on the control device, as an interface between an application on the electronic device and the vehicle bus, is relieved by reducing the tasks of the interface to a pure switching and transport function. For this purpose, essential functional components or the application-related layers of a bus implementation, for example a CAN bus implementation, are not implemented in the control device but rather are moved to the application in the electronic device. As a result, some of the computation power produced per se in the control device is moved to the electronic device. This is particularly advantageous because a more modern electronic device which replaces an older electronic device is generally more powerful and is thus able to compensate for the possibly higher demands imposed on the computation power, and the control device can thus continue to be used without disadvantages despite the higher demand. The data link layer is divided between the control device and the electronic device and forms the basis of the link between the two implementations. In this case, it is particularly advantageous that the hardware of a control device installed in the vehicle does not need to be updated when using different, possibly modernized electronic devices. Rather, the installation of a suitable application on the hardware of the electronic device is sufficient. This ensures full upward compatibility with regard to the electronic device used.
Furthermore, the essence of the invention is to establish direct communication between the electronic device and the control device, which communication takes place in a language of the connected vehicle bus or in a protocol defined for the data link layer, with the result that no translation or only minor translation of the received and transmitted data packets is required in the devices involved. The data packets are thus interchanged between the two devices without complicated protocol conversion. This saves computation power which would otherwise have to be provided by the control device.
In the sense of the invention, a control device is understood as meaning a gateway unit or interface unit, a gateway unit in the sense of the invention being an electronic device which makes it possible to connect an electronic device to a vehicle bus, and an interface unit in the sense of the invention being an electronic device which, as an interface, enables communication between the vehicle bus and the electronic device, the electronic device being designed, in particular, as a mobile electronic device and, in particular, as a mobile telephone.
In the sense of the invention, the layers of a layer model, which has seven layers for example, are denoted using the technical terms mentioned below.
The seventh layer is referred to as the application layer. The seventh or uppermost layer is defined by the application itself and comprises the actual application software.
The sixth layer is referred to as the presentation layer. The presentation layer is responsible for data conversion and for encrypting the data.
The fifth layer is referred to as the session layer. The session layer is responsible for controlling data flow and for dialog control.
The fourth layer is referred to as the transport layer. The transport layer is responsible for transmitting the data packets.
The third layer is referred to as the network layer. The network layer is responsible for setting up connections. This also includes routing and the stipulation of the data path.
The second layer is referred to as the data link layer. This level controls access to the physical level.
The first layer is referred to as the physical layer. The physical level describes the physical, hardware level of the control device.
Further details of the invention are described using schematically illustrated exemplary embodiments in the drawings.
The invention is not restricted to illustrated or described exemplary embodiments. Rather, it comprises developments of the invention within the scope of the claims.
Number | Date | Country | Kind |
---|---|---|---|
10 2011 010 400.3 | Feb 2011 | DE | national |
This application is an application claiming the benefit under 35 USC §119(e) of U.S. Provisional Application 61/553,470 having a filing date of Oct. 31, 2011 and claims the benefit under 35, USC §119(a)-(d) of German Application No. 10 2011 010 400.3 filed Feb. 4, 2011, the entireties of which are incorporated herein by reference.
Number | Date | Country | |
---|---|---|---|
61553470 | Oct 2011 | US |